位置: 编程技术 - 正文

详谈Python2.6和Python3.0中对除法操作的异同(python中2和2.0的区别)

编辑:rootadmin

推荐整理分享详谈Python2.6和Python3.0中对除法操作的异同(python中2和2.0的区别),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:python3和2.7的区别,python2和2.0相等吗,python3.6和2.7,python2.7和3.6区别,python中2和2.0的区别,python2.7和3.6区别,python2.7和3.6区别,python3.6和2.7,内容如对您有帮助,希望把文章链接给更多的朋友!

Python中除法有两种运算符:'/'和'//';有三种类型的除法:传统除法、Floor除法和真除法。

X / Y类型:

在Python2.6或者之前,这个操作对于整数运算会省去小数部分,而对于浮点数运算会保持小数部分;在Python3.0中变成真除法(无论任何类型都会保持小数部分,即使整除也会表示为浮点数形式)。

示例代码:

Python 2.7版本中结果:

Python 3.4版本中结果:

X // Y 类型:

Floor除法:在Python 2.2中新增的操作,在Python2.6和Python3.0中均能使用,这个操作不考虑操作对象的类型,总是省略小数部分,剩下最小的能整除的整数部分。

示例代码:

Python 2.7版本中结果:

详谈Python2.6和Python3.0中对除法操作的异同(python中2和2.0的区别)

Python 3.4版本中结果(与2.7版本一样):

概括

来讲:

&#; 在Python 2.6中,'/'执行传统除法,如果操作数都是整数的话,执行截断的整数除法(即对于结果只保留整数部分),否则,执行浮点除法(保留余数);'//'执行Floor除法,与Python3.0一样,对于整数执行截断除法,浮点数执行浮点除法。

&#; 在Python 3.0中,'/'总是执行真除法,不管操作数的类型,都会返回包含任何余数的浮点结果;'//'执行Floor除法,截除掉余数并且针对整数操作数返回一个整数,如果有任何一个操作数是浮点数,则返回一个浮点数。

-------------------------------------------------

补充:

Floor除法:效果等同于math模块中的floor函数:

math.floor(x) :返回不大于x的整数

所以当运算数是负数时:结果会向下取整。

与floor()函数类似的还有很多,比如trunc()函数:

以上这篇详谈Python2.6和Python3.0中对除法操作的异同就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持积木网。

Python、PyCharm安装及使用方法(Mac版)详解 上周跟朋友喝咖啡时聊起我想学Python,她恰好也有这个打算,顺便推荐了一本书《编程小白的第1本Python入门书》,我推送到Kindle后,随手翻看了下,用

python 使用get_argument获取url query参数 python使用get_argument获取urlquery参数ornado的每个请求处理程序,我们叫做handler,handler里可以自定义自己的处理程序,其实也就是重写方法,如post,get,get

Python 通过pip安装Django详细介绍 Python通过pip安装Django详细介绍经过前面的Python包管理工具的学习,接下来我们就要基于前面的知识,来配置Django的开发与运行环境。首先是安装Django(

标签: python中2和2.0的区别

本文链接地址:https://www.jiuchutong.com/biancheng/375574.html 转载请保留说明!

上一篇:浅谈Python2.6和Python3.0中八进制数字表示的区别(python2.7和3.8)

下一篇:python 使用get_argument获取url query参数(python中get怎么用)

  • 税务局开票需要交钱吗
  • 工资用现金发放有风险吗?
  • 合营企业和联营企业会计核算
  • 印花税的填报方法
  • 开办期间的费用,没有发票,咋抵扣啊
  • 收入比开票多如何处理好
  • 赞助费账务处理
  • 财务利润率
  • 餐饮企业原材料四大类
  • 车购税申报表如何作废重开
  • 二手房怎么避免一房多卖
  • 企业自建房产可以抵押吗
  • 一般纳税人每个月几号报税
  • 有哪些发票可以开成餐饮服务
  • 独资合伙企业的所有者用于承担企业财务风险的财产是
  • 期末调汇的会计科目
  • 给员工缴纳保险
  • 个体工商户该如何交税
  • 利润表中企业所得税
  • 增值税普通发票需要交税吗
  • 软件企业两免三减半税收政策到期
  • 如何理解纳税人资格
  • 2020水利基金
  • 增值税是什么鬼
  • 对方开具红字发票过来怎么做进项税转出
  • 发票开负数冲红做什么会计分录?
  • 政府奖励金额是否要交二次税呢
  • 打车进项可以抵扣吗
  • 如何修改电脑默认打印机
  • 银行手续费扣除比例
  • 公司估值一般不超过市值多少
  • win10系统怎么设置
  • 房地产企业何时结转利润
  • PHP:Memcached::getServerByKey()的用法_Memcached类
  • PHP:ftp_set_option()的用法_FTP函数
  • PHP:ignore_user_abort()的用法_misc函数
  • 软件企业高新技术有哪些
  • 分包工程账务处理
  • 增值税及附加税是什么意思
  • 南美貘叫什么
  • thinkphp删除文件
  • 前端面试题基础篇
  • js经典案例代码大全
  • 待抵扣进项税额和进项税额的区别
  • 事业单位无形资产折旧是当月还是下月
  • 个人账户收到多少钱会被监控
  • 第三方车行
  • 主营业务收入未收到钱
  • 建安企业确认收入的依据
  • 销售费用和管理费用占比多少合理
  • 一般纳税人交增值税的账务处理
  • 道路货物运输服务税率
  • 城市生活垃圾处理费征收管理办法
  • 简易计税方法缴纳城建税和教育税
  • 离线开票时间超限怎么办 发票都已经报送
  • 减免税款科目期末有余额吗
  • 土地使用权入账务处理
  • 投资性房地产处置的账务处理
  • 查账征收的个体户怎么交个税
  • sql2005 create file遇到操作系统错误5拒绝访问 错误1802
  • IIS7在Windows Server 2008R2的新改进
  • win8系统故障了怎么办
  • linux的tar
  • xp系统进入桌面后没反应
  • win7系统玩游戏怎么样
  • win7旗舰版开机
  • jquery插件使用教程
  • linux tcptraceroute
  • reg add命令
  • zigzag源码
  • linux实现shell代码
  • 多线程python爬虫
  • 面向对象的三大特征
  • android 获取时区
  • 临时工工资需要申报吗
  • 湖南省五一劳动奖章
  • 残疾人拿药能报销吗?
  • 自然人电子税务局web端怎么进入
  • 我国现行税率分
  • 税务绩效工作存在的问题
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设